Transaction d4fbf20cf608e443bbba80564ca1788616830a1dd3ef2fee9d672bf65029c421

39 Input
2 Outputs
  • d4fbf20cf608e443bbba80564ca1788616830a1dd3ef2fee9d672bf65029c421:0
  • value  777758975
    address  3Bi4LoesrYdcKJNPpukYBgeRtgAJoQoLLR
  • d4fbf20cf608e443bbba80564ca1788616830a1dd3ef2fee9d672bf65029c421:1
  • value  824181
    address  3FjE4vctcffaBVvAiA2BcDg12ujvZj6a4k